Your Child’s First Dental Visit
For many kids, visiting the dentist for the first time can be a fearful experience. At Crater Lake Dental, we understand this reality, so we strive to make their first dental appointments enjoyable and relaxed.
To that end, we’ll ensure the visit is a short one. First, your child will meet and chat with the dentist for a few minutes. Engaging your child in playful conversation can help put them at ease and set a fun, light-hearted tone for the rest of the visit.
Next, we’ll take a look at your child’s teeth. This is a very gentle exam. During this exam, we’ll check for signs of tooth decay, examine the bite, and check the gums, jaw, and oral tissues. If necessary, we’ll also gently clean the teeth.
Finally, we will talk to you and your child about good oral health habits, educate your child on how to brush and floss their teeth, and give you ideas on how to encourage these healthy habits in your little one’s routine.
Healthy Changes for a Lifetime of Smiles
Some of the topics we may discuss with you and your child may include the following:
- Healthy habits and oral hygiene practices, including brushing and flossing.
- How to prevent cavities.
- Uses and advantages of fluoride.
- Developmental milestones.
- Teething and losing baby teeth.
- Healthy diet as well as foods to avoid.
- Importance of visiting the dentist every six months.
- How to deal with negative oral habits, including thumb sucking and tongue thrusting.
